Nissan 544888 Differential Carrier for 2014 Pathfinder AWD: A Comprehensive Analysis
The Nissan 544888 differential carrier is an essential component in the all-wheel-drive (AWD) system of the 2014 Nissan Pathfinder. This part is responsible for transferring power from the transmission to the rear axle. In this analysis, we will discuss the pros and cons of buying this differential carrier to help you make an informed decision.
Pros:
1. OEM Part: The Nissan 544888 differential carrier is an original equipment manufacturer (OEM) part. This means it is specifically designed and engineered for your vehicle by Nissan, ensuring a perfect fit and optimal performance.
2. Superior Quality: OEM parts are generally of higher quality compared to aftermarket alternatives. They undergo rigorous testing and meet strict manufacturing standards, ensuring durability and reliability.
3. Enhanced Drivability: A faulty or worn-out differential carrier can cause various drivability issues, such as vibrations, noise, or poor traction. Replacing it with a new OEM part can help improve your driving experience.
Cons:
1. Cost: OEM parts, including the Nissan 544888 differential carrier, tend to be more expensive than aftermarket alternatives. This could be a significant consideration for those on a tight budget.
2. Availability: OEM parts may take longer to obtain compared to aftermarket alternatives. You may need to wait for the part to be shipped from the manufacturer or an authorized dealer, which could lead to additional downtime for your vehicle.
3. Limited Customization: Since OEM parts are designed to fit and perform optimally within the specifications of the vehicle, they offer limited customization options.
Conclusion:
When considering the purchase of the Nissan 544888 differential carrier for your 2014 Pathfinder AWD, it's essential to weigh the pros and cons. The advantages include the superior quality, perfect fit, and enhanced drivability that come with an OEM part. However, the cons include the higher cost, potential longer wait times for availability, and limited customization options. Ultimately, the decision depends on your priorities, budget, and urgency for the repair. If you value the peace of mind that comes with using a high-quality, genuine OEM part, the investment may be worthwhile. However, if cost is a significant concern, an aftermarket alternative may be a more suitable option.
